This study investigates the presence and risk assessment of microplastics (MPs) at Quilon Beach, India, revealing an average abundance of 3145 ± 2515 MPs/kg of sand, primarily composed of polyester and acrylonitrile butadiene styrene. The research identifies anthropogenic activities, such as sewage effluents and tourism, as significant sources of MPs pollution. The study employs Pollution Load Index (PLI) and Pollution Hazard Index (PHI) to assess the degree of contamination in the beach environment.
